Facility and Process Description Boggs Materials, Inc. -Pee Dee Asphalt Plant is a portable continuous drum-type hot mix asphalt plant with a screen and feed system for adding recycled asphalt pavement(RAP). Inspection Summary: On 31 July 2019 I Mike Thomas and Evangelyn Lowery-Jacobs both of FRO DAQ, conducted a compliance inspection of this facility. This plant has not operated since 2011. We verified that all permitted equipment, dryer, surge bin, silo, conveyor,and screens have been removed from the property.Upon returning to the office,I called the facility contact, Tim Melton and inquired if there were any plans to reopen the facility. Mr.Melton stated that there were no plans to reopen the plant in the near future. VI. 112R Status This facility does not store any of the listed chemicals above the threshold quantities, and therefore is not required to maintain a written Risk Management Plan(RMP). VH. Non-compliance History Since 2010 2/17/17 NOD for late reporting. 2/25/14 NOD for late reporting. VIH. Comments and Compliance Statement Boggs Materials,Inc. -Pee Dee Asphalt Plant appeared to be in compliance with the specific conditions found in the facility's current Air Permit on 31 July 2019.
